
M
±15kV ESD-Protected USB Transceivers
______________________________________________________________________________________
11
Disable Mode
Connect V
BUS
to a system power supply and leave V
L
unconnected or connect to GND. D+ and D- enter a tri-
state mode and V
BUS
(or V
BUS
and V
TRM
) consumes
less than 20μA of supply current. D+ and D- withstand
external signals up to +5.5V in disable mode (Table 2).
Sharing Mode
Connect V
L
to a system power supply and leave V
BUS
(or V
BUS
and V
TRM
) unconnected or connect to GND.
D+ and D- enter a tri-state mode, allowing other circuitry
to share the USB D+ and D- lines, and V
L
consumes less
than 20μA of supply current. D+ and D- withstand
external signals up to +5.5V in sharing mode (Table 2).
Device Control
OE
OE
controls the direction of communication. Drive
OE
low to transfer data from the logic side to the USB side.
For
OE
= low, VP and VM serve as differential driver
inputs to the USB transmitter.
Drive
OE
high to transfer data from the USB side to the
logic side. For
OE
= high, VP and VM serve as single-
ended receiver outputs from the USB inputs
(D+ and D-). RCV serves as a differential receiver out-
put, regardless of the state of
OE
.
ENUM (MAX3453E/MAX3454E)
The MAX3453E/MAX3454E feature an enumerate func-
tion that allows software control of USB enumeration.
USB protocol requires a 1.5k
pullup resistor to D+ or
D- to indicate the transmission speed to the host (see
the
SPD
section). The MAX3453E/MAX3454E provide
an internal 1.5k
pullup resistor. Disconnect the pullup
resistor from the circuit to simulate the removal of a
device from the USB. Drive ENUM low to disconnect
the internal pullup resistor. Drive ENUM high to connect
the internal pullup resistor. The SPD state (MAX3454E
only) determines whether the pullup resistor connects
to D+ or D-. For ENUM = high, the internal pullup resis-
tor connects to D+ when SPD = V
L
(full speed) or to D-
when SPD = GND (low speed). The MAX3453E only
supports full-speed operation; therefore, the pullup
resistor only connects to D+ or is disconnected.
Figure 1. Rise and Fall Times
V
OHD
V
OLD
90%
10%
90%
10%
t
FR
, t
LR
t
FF
, t
LF
Table 3a. Transmit Truth Table
(
OE
= 0, SUS = 0)
INPUTS
VP
0
0
1
1
OUTPUTS
D-
0
1
0
1
VM
0
1
0
1
D+
0
0
1
1
RCV
X
0
1
X
OUTPUT STATE
SE0
Logic 0
Logic 1
Undefined
X
= Undefined.
Table 3b. Transmit Truth Table
(
OE
= 0, SUS = 1)
INPUTS
VP
0
0
1
1
OUTPUTS
D-
0
1
0
1
VM
0
1
0
1
D+
0
0
1
1
RCV
0
0
0
0
OUTPUT STATE
SE0
Logic 0
Logic 1
Undefined
Table 4a. Receive Truth Table
(
OE
= 1 and SUS = 0)
INPUTS
D+
0
0
1
1
OUTPUTS
VM
0
1
0
1
D-
0
1
0
1
VP
0
0
1
1
RCV
X
0
1
X
OUTPUT STATE
SE0
Logic 0
Logic 1
Undefined
X
= Undefined.
Table 4b. Receive Truth Table
(
OE
= 1 and SUS = 1)
INPUTS
D+
0
0
1
1
OUTPUTS
VM
0
1
0
1
D-
0
1
0
1
VP
0
0
1
1
RCV
0
0
0
0
OUTPUT STATE
SE0
Logic 0
Logic 1
Undefined